What is an Assessment Centre?

An Assessment Centre consists of a variety of testing techniques designed to allow candidates to demonstrate, under standardized conditions, the skills and abilities that are most essential for success in a given job. This  is a selection event bringing together a group of candidates who undertake a series of exercises and assessments including job-related simulations, interviews, presentations, a series of aptitude tests or a case study linked to the job function that you have applied for.

They are expensive to run... so if you get to this stage, you are very close to a job offer!!
